Rechercher : dans
Par :

Découpage d'un fichier texte

Dernière réponse le 4 jun 2007 à 13:10:09 sebas78, le 4 jun 2007 à 11:13:40 
 Signaler ce message aux modérateurs

Bonjour,

Pouvez-vous svp m'indiquer s'il y a une commande sous dos pour découper un fichier avec les 100000 premières lignes par exemple, j'ai essayé la commande suivante cela ne marche pas car il ne me ressort que les 10 premières lignes :

head 200 Fichierentré.txt > Fichiersortietxt

D'avance merci.

Configuration: Windows XP
Internet Explorer 6.0

Meilleures réponses pour « Découpage d'un fichier texte » dans :
MySQL - Chargement d'un fichier texte dans une table VoirPour charger une fichier texte défini comme suit : $ tail /home/user1/test.txt 'nom1',1,9 'nom2',2,3 'nom3',3,54 'nom4',4,2 'nom5',5,9 Dans une table définie comme suit : CREATE TABLE chargertest ( ...
Qu'est-ce qu'un fichier? VoirQu'est-ce qu'un fichier? Un fichier est une suite d'informations binaires, c'est-à-dire une suite de 0 et de 1. Ce fichier peut être stocké pour garder une trace de ces informations. Un fichier texte est un fichier composé de caractères stockés...
Extensions de fichiers VoirIntroduction aux fichiers Un fichier est une suite d'informations binaires, c'est-à-dire une suite de 0 et de 1. Ce fichier peut être stocké pour garder une trace de ces informations. Un fichier texte est un fichier composé de caractères stockés...
Fichier TXT VoirFormat TXT Un fichier TXT est un fichier texte, c'est-à-dire un simple fichier contenant du texte au format ASCII. Pour ouvrir ou modifier un tel fichier, il suffit d'utiliser le bloc-notes ou un éditeur de texte traditionnel.

1

jipicy, le 4 jun 2007 à 11:39:52

Salut,

On est sur le Forum GNU/Linux là !!!

Donc soit tu tapes :

head -200 Fichierentré.txt > Fichiersortietxt
soit :
sed '200q' Fichierentré.txt > Fichiersortietxt
ou encore :
sed -n '1,200p' Fichierentré.txt > Fichiersortietxt
;-)) Z'@+...che.
JP : Zen, my Nuggets ! ;-)
Le savoir n'est bon que s'il est partagé.

Répondre à jipicy

2

jee pee, le 4 jun 2007 à 13:04:48

Bonjour, ce post était dans le forum "suggestions". J'ai suggéré qu'il soit déplacé. Et déplacé vers "Linux/unix", car la commande head n'existe pas en ms-dos, mais bien sous unix. Et c'est surement l'endroit ad-hoc puisqu'il y a des spécialistes qui savent répondre à la question :-) cdt

Répondre à jee pee

3

 jipicy, le 4 jun 2007 à 13:10:09

I know : "Ce message n'est pas posté dans le bon forum, il faudrait le rediriger vers le forum suivant : linux je pense car head n'a jamais été une commande dos ??"

;-)) Z'@+...che.

JP : Zen, my Nuggets ! ;-)
Le savoir n'est bon que s'il est partagé.

Répondre à jipicy